Peter Ilyich Tchaikovsky

Summary

Peter Ilyich Tchaikovsky's brilliant ability for composition emerged at a relatively late age. He began studying music after graduating in Jurisprudence at the age of 19. His progress was so rapid that he became a professor of harmony one year after obtaining his music degree from the St. Petersburg Conservatory. By the time he was thirty, he had already composed many highly regarded works. His ability to enjoy his success was hampered by extreme emotional anxiety, due to lack of personal and social acceptance for his homosexuality.
